Onset adds summer flare at annual Illumination Night

Jul 30, 2017

Thousands of red flares, some sparklers, light-up toys and fire dancers sparkled across Onset Beach Saturday night at the annual Illumination Night.

Illumination Night, one of the Onset Bay Association's many events of the summer, drew thousands of people to Onset to celebrate summer. The evening included a music parade featuring the Second Line Social Aid Pleasure Society Brass Band and a fire dancing performance by Circus Dynamics.

The main event came at 9 p.m., when the Onset Fire horn sounded and the flares were lit from Burgess Point to Shell Point.

Illumination Night has been an Onset tradition for over 100 years and brings many Wareham residents and visitors from out of town. The event was paid for in part by a Festivals Grant from the Massachusetts Cultural Council.
